Lakeshore Public Radio's Dee Dotson and Tom Maloney host a panel discussion with Holly Wade, NFIB Indiana Director; Neil Samahon, President and CEO Opportunity Enterprises representing NWI small business and Barbara Quandt, NFIB Regional Director covering nine states including Indiana. Each year, NFIB hosts an advocacy event for small business owners: the Washington, D.C. Fly-In.
